@ManagedResource(description="Managed TransformerRegistry") public class ManagedTransformerRegistry extends ManagedService implements ManagedTransformerRegistryMBean
Constructor and Description |
---|
ManagedTransformerRegistry(CamelContext context,
TransformerRegistry transformerRegistry) |
Modifier and Type | Method and Description |
---|---|
Integer |
getDynamicSize() |
Integer |
getMaximumCacheSize() |
Integer |
getSize() |
String |
getSource() |
Integer |
getStaticSize() |
TransformerRegistry |
getTransformerRegistry() |
void |
init(ManagementStrategy strategy) |
TabularData |
listTransformers() |
void |
purge() |
getCamelId, getCamelManagementName, getContext, getInstance, getRoute, getRouteId, getService, getServiceType, getState, isStaticService, isSupportSuspension, isSuspended, resume, setRoute, start, stop, suspend
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getCamelId, getCamelManagementName, getRouteId, getServiceType, getState, isStaticService, isSupportSuspension, isSuspended, resume, start, stop, suspend
public ManagedTransformerRegistry(CamelContext context, TransformerRegistry transformerRegistry)
public void init(ManagementStrategy strategy)
init
in class ManagedService
public TransformerRegistry getTransformerRegistry()
public String getSource()
getSource
in interface ManagedTransformerRegistryMBean
public Integer getDynamicSize()
getDynamicSize
in interface ManagedTransformerRegistryMBean
public Integer getStaticSize()
getStaticSize
in interface ManagedTransformerRegistryMBean
public Integer getSize()
getSize
in interface ManagedTransformerRegistryMBean
public Integer getMaximumCacheSize()
getMaximumCacheSize
in interface ManagedTransformerRegistryMBean
public void purge()
purge
in interface ManagedTransformerRegistryMBean
public TabularData listTransformers()
listTransformers
in interface ManagedTransformerRegistryMBean
Apache Camel